This is who I am

I have nothing but inspiration around me and I just want to sing about it. My mom is a Dr, and my Dad a grammy award winning jazz musician. I started singing when I was just 4 in church, school, city choirs and the usual places in Franklin Tennessee, about 30 minutes south of Nashville. I also play piano, dance and act. As I got older I became very interested in sports, especially track and field where I excelled in the hammer and discus throw. I even won conference for the  woman's weight and hammer throw while in college at Samford University. In 2019 I graduated with a degree in communications, and it was back to music with a few changes. I still love to work out and decided to drop more than 45 pounds on my new journey. I then began working hard on my music and got offers to sing the national anthem at Nashville Predators, Vanderbilt and other school games. I've also been grinding in the studio working on my own solo project, releasing an EP and singles while doing covers on YouTube and dancing on TikTok - that's fun! Now it's all about being on top of the world while sharing my gift of music and writing songs that mean everything to me.
